Oracle is not a fat pitch despite setup

Despite a clean technical setup, Oracle does not qualify as a high-conviction 'fat pitch' due to structural growth questions.

The argument

The hosts argued that while the risk-reward ratio is clear, the stock's intense downtrend is driven by fundamental questions - such as pressure from OpenAI's spending commitments - that won't easily be resolved by a quick bounce.

The thesis, stress-tested
✓ What validates it
  • Continued downward pressure on cloud margins
  • Earnings reports failing to address long-term competitive threats from AI players
▸ Risks discussed
  • A sudden resolution of cloud spending concerns or massive earnings beats could trigger a sharp V-shaped recovery
